I don't know if these will physically fit as a replacement, but the
"Img Stage Line MHD-152" horn is doubtless much better than the piezo
tweeters. It is 8 ohms, has a -6db range from 0,8 - 20 kHz straight
ahead, and sensitivity of 102 dB (2,83 V, 4 kHz, 1 m distance). It is
not cheap though, 110 euro in Germany. Measured under 30 degrees
horizontally it's about 10 dB less (that's a good value, and it's
constant directivity, meaning the 10 dB is fairly constant even if
the frequency gets higher). Vertically 30 degrees off, it is much
more, 20-30 dB less.

Usable from 2 kHz upwards, because of some resonances below it: you
need to put it behind an 18 dB 2 kHz high pass filter (one L, 2 C).
